From: Jerome Marchand <jmarchan@redhat.com> Date: Wed, 26 May 2010 14:59:53 -0400 Subject: [fs] proc: add file position and flags info in /proc Message-id: <4BFD3769.9040102@redhat.com> Patchwork-id: 25819 O-Subject: [RHEL5 PATCH] Add file position and flags infos in /proc Bugzilla: 498081 RH-Acked-by: Amerigo Wang <amwang@redhat.com> Bugzilla: https://bugzilla.redhat.com/show_bug.cgi?id=582672 Description: Add entries /proc/<pid>/fdinfo/<fd> and /proc/<pid>/task/<tid>/fdinfo/<fd> entries. They contains file position and flags information. I also modified fake_ino() to ensure that pid-dir entries inode numbers stay in their allocated range (0x0001xxxx-0x7fffxxxx) and avoid any conflict with dynamic entries (range 0xf0000000-0xffffffff). There still can be duplicate inodes among the pid-dir entries, but procfs does not care about that.
